Marbury v. Madison established what constitutional principle?

Marbury v. Madison, 5 U.S. (1 Cranch) 137 (1803), was a U.S. Supreme Court case that established the principle of judicial review in the United States, meaning that American courts have the power to strike down laws, statutes, and some government actions that contravene the U.S. Constitution.

How were the changes that took place in russia as a result of world war i different from those that took place in western europe

In Western Europe, the war was largely a stalemate as a result of extensive trench warfare that gave the defenders a massive advantage during battles. In Russia, however, the monarchy was overthrown by rebels, who then negotiated peace and surrendered large chunks of land to the Germans, allowing them to concentrate all their troops and resources to the Western Front.
